Starting a fire that gets out of control and causes property damage can lead to charges of arson in Texas. It is not against the law to have a campfire or to burn trash in certain areas, but a fire that gets out of hand can be a serious matter.

A statute of limitations exists for almost every type of crime or wrongdoing. These time limitations prevent the government from pursuing people for years after committing an offense.
